I’LL TAKE A DOZEN PACKBOTS TO GO, PLEASE
iRobot Corp. (
www.irobot.com) has received an order totaling $16.8 million
from the US Army Program Executive Office for Simulation, Training, and
Instrumentation (PEO STRI).
This order marks the first purchase of iRobot's advanced PackBot 510 series
under an existing $200 million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) contract.
The PackBot 510 series provides the Army with advanced robotic capabilities that
surpass those of the battle-tested PackBot 500.
The PackBot 510 with EOD Kit has advanced vision and surveillance capabilities.
It easily adapts to different Improvised Explosive Device (IED) missions including check
points, inspections, and route clearance. The robot provides soldiers with a tool to
identify and dispose of IEDs, roadside bombs, and other unexploded ordnance while
keeping them at safe distances. Additionally, the PackBot 510 provides improved lift and
manipulation capabilities, greater speed, military-standard batteries, a hardened laptop
with game-style hand controller, and a variety of other upgrades that enhance its
mission effectiveness.

Automated Pet Care Products, Inc., the makers of the Litter-Robot™,
have some new products and accessories to help cat owners
customize their Litter-Robot to
match their cat's individual needs.
New products and accessories
include the Bubble Globe,
Lip Extender, and the
Litter-Robot Ramp.
The Bubble Globe is a
skylight-type window mounted to the
back of the Globe that adds three inches in the front-to-back depth of
the litter chamber. The Bubble Globe provides natural lighting to the litter
chamber and the extra depth helps to accommodate larger cats.
The Lip Extender is designed for cats that have not mastered turning
around in the Globe and 'miss their target.'
The Litter-Robot Ramp can serve as a ramp to help elderly or small
cats get into the Litter-Robot. It’s also a scratch pad and can catch
tracked litter to keep the area neat and tidy.
Litter-Robot is the only automated, self-cleaning litter box product
made in the US. Go to

A FACE ONLY A MOTHER ...
ThatsMyFace and MechRC (www.mech
rc.com) have partnered up to offer an
advanced humanoid robot featuring your
very own face! That’s right! You can order a
MechRC robot with a 3D replica of your
own head mounted to it.
Simply take some pictures of your face,
upload them to
www.thatsmyface.com, and
mark some options. You’ll soon receive your
robotic replica, ready to go.
